Skip site navigation (1)Skip section navigation (2)
Date:      Thu, 21 Aug 2014 19:04:32 +0000 (UTC)
From:      Antoine Brodin <antoine@FreeBSD.org>
To:        ports-committers@freebsd.org, svn-ports-all@freebsd.org, svn-ports-head@freebsd.org
Subject:   svn commit: r365583 - in head/sysutils/abck: . files
Message-ID:  <201408211904.s7LJ4WBW030182@svn.freebsd.org>

next in thread | raw e-mail | index | archive | help
Author: antoine
Date: Thu Aug 21 19:04:32 2014
New Revision: 365583
URL: http://svnweb.freebsd.org/changeset/ports/365583
QAT: https://qat.redports.org/buildarchive/r365583/

Log:
  - Allow staging as a regular user
  - Shebangfix

Modified:
  head/sysutils/abck/Makefile
  head/sysutils/abck/files/patch-Makefile

Modified: head/sysutils/abck/Makefile
==============================================================================
--- head/sysutils/abck/Makefile	Thu Aug 21 18:51:57 2014	(r365582)
+++ head/sysutils/abck/Makefile	Thu Aug 21 19:04:32 2014	(r365583)
@@ -3,12 +3,16 @@
 
 PORTNAME=	abck
 PORTVERSION=	2.2
+PORTREVISION=	1
 CATEGORIES=	sysutils
 MASTER_SITES=	http://www.tundraware.com/Software/abck/
 
 MAINTAINER=	tundra@tundraware.com
 COMMENT=	Manage intrusion attempts recorded in the system log
 
-USE_PYTHON=	yes
+USES=		python shebangfix
+SHEBANG_FILES=	abck
+python_OLD_CMD=	/usr/local/bin/python
+python_CMD=	${PYTHON_CMD}
 
 .include <bsd.port.mk>

Modified: head/sysutils/abck/files/patch-Makefile
==============================================================================
--- head/sysutils/abck/files/patch-Makefile	Thu Aug 21 18:51:57 2014	(r365582)
+++ head/sysutils/abck/files/patch-Makefile	Thu Aug 21 19:04:32 2014	(r365583)
@@ -1,5 +1,5 @@
---- Makefile.orig	2014-06-26 22:31:16.566637227 +0800
-+++ Makefile	2014-06-26 22:31:40.165642393 +0800
+--- Makefile.orig	2002-09-04 21:55:45 UTC
++++ Makefile
 @@ -4,7 +4,7 @@
  all:	# Do nothing - this is a python script that needs no build
  
@@ -8,7 +8,7 @@
 -	mkdir ${PREFIX}/share/doc/abck
 -	install -c -o root -g wheel -m 644 ./abck.1.gz ${PREFIX}/man/man1
 -	install -c -o root -g wheel -m 644 ./abck-License.txt ${PREFIX}/share/doc/abck
-+	install -c -o root -g wheel -m 700 ./abck $(DESTDIR)${PREFIX}/bin
-+	mkdir $(DESTDIR)${PREFIX}/share/doc/abck
-+	install -c -o root -g wheel -m 644 ./abck.1.gz $(DESTDIR)${PREFIX}/man/man1
-+	install -c -o root -g wheel -m 644 ./abck-License.txt $(DESTDIR)${PREFIX}/share/doc/abck
++	${BSD_INSTALL_SCRIPT} ./abck ${DESTDIR}${PREFIX}/bin
++	mkdir ${DESTDIR}${PREFIX}/share/doc/abck
++	${BSD_INSTALL_MAN} ./abck.1.gz ${DESTDIR}${PREFIX}/man/man1
++	${BSD_INSTALL_DATA} ./abck-License.txt ${DESTDIR}${PREFIX}/share/doc/abck



Want to link to this message? Use this URL: <https://mail-archive.FreeBSD.org/cgi/mid.cgi?201408211904.s7LJ4WBW030182>